Why Abortion Should be Made Legal Across the World
Abortion is an extremely controversial topic in today’s society. Currently, abortion is legal in Canada; however, in other countries it is not. Mexico, Brazil, and Ireland are just a few countries that have made abortion illegal. Only few states in the USA have made it completely legal or legal in certain circumstances. Across the world, abortion is frowned upon and only used for specific reasons, such as if the mother of the fetus was in danger due to the pregnancy. Abortion should be made completely legal across the world because it can eliminate unsafe abortions, prevent suffering from mother and child, and it promote the rights of women. Everyone has the right to choose what they do with their own body. By taking away the right for a woman to receive a safe abortion, it taking away women’s rights. It is not fair that women are constantly being forced to comply with society’s standards of them. Women are expected to act a certain way or comply with the conservative ways that were done in the past. By making abortion legal, women can start to make their own choices about their body and their lives. Allowing abortion does not mean that everyone must get an abortion; it means that whoever wants a safe abortion has the option to do so. Being pro-choice allows for women to freely choose what they want for themselves; and if they do not get an abortion then that is fine too. Women should not be judged on their choices. There are many different situations that can occur in relation to abortion; but no matter what the mother chooses, there should never be any judgement. A young girl may choose to follow through with her pregnancy while another lady chooses to have an abortion due to her inability to support a child; regardless of the situation, neither women should be judged. Women should have the right to choose whether to have an abortion or not. Children are a wonderful creation, but they are also a huge commitment.
